您在此处:程序编辑器快速入门 > 调试程序和处理错误

调试程序和处理错误

您在编写函数或程序后,您可以使用几种方法查找并更正错误。您可以将错误处理命令内置于函数或程序本身。

如果函数或程序允许用户从多个选项选择,请确保运行它并测试每个选项。

调试方法

运行时错误消息可以查找语法错误,但不能查找程序逻辑错误。以下方法可能很有用。

暂时插入 Disp 命令以显示关键变量的值。
要确认循环已执行正确的次数,请使用 Disp 命令显示计数器变量或条件测试中的值。
要确认子程序已执行,请使用 Disp 命令在子程序开头或结尾处显示“进入子程序”和“退出子程序”等消息。
手动停止程序或功能:
- Windows®:按住 F12 键,并反复按 Enter 键。
- Macintosh®:按住 F5 键,并反复按 Enter 键。
- 手持设备: 按住 c 键,并反复按· 键。

错误处理命令

 

命令

说明

Try...EndTry

定义一个块,可让函数或程序执行命令,并且在需要时,从该命令生成的错误恢复。

ClrErr

清除错误状态,并将系统变量 errCode 设为零。 要查看 errCode 的使用范例,请参阅参考指南中的 Try 命令。

PassErr

将错误传递至 Try...EndTry 块的下一级。

 

© 2006 - 2016 Texas Instruments Incorporated